About the role

Full-Time, Permanent

As the Recreation Program Coordinator – Initiatives and Events, you “Take Care of Banff” by coordinating services that encourage participation in accessible community programs. You collaborate with programmers, contractors, businesses and local volunteers to deliver a range of activities, events and initiatives that support the well-being of the community.

You blend your organizational and administrative strengths, allowing you to listen and respond appropriately to the needs and concerns of this community. Your tactical skills are matched by your empathy and passion for educating individuals on the health benefits of social and physical activity in the town and in Banff National Park. You thrive on collaboration and are committed to working with our network of agencies and individuals to deliver diversity and cross-cultural experiences.

As the Recreation Programmer, you are responsible for the planning, coordination, and delivery of recreation initiatives and events, including community programs, event permitting, and customer service. You work closely with internal and external stakeholders to enhance recreation services and ensure meaningful community engagement. This role includes collecting, summarizing, and presenting community feedback, as well as planning and executing a variety of year-round events for all ages. Programming is designed to connect participants with nature, foster active living, and increase inclusion and access for populations facing barriers. Additionally, you help create supportive physical and social environments that encourage participation, build community, and reflect best practices, trends, and emerging needs.

The hours of work for this position is 35 hours per week with shifts scheduled dependent on your programs and events.
